Weekend bar jobs can usually be categorized into three primary roles: bartender, barback, and server. Bartenders are responsible for preparing and serving drinks, creating cocktails, and offering wonderful customer service. Barbacks help bartenders by restocking supplies, cleaning glasses, and making certain the bar space is tidy. Servers often work in restaurants or bars, serving food and drinks to customers. Each role performs a significant part in creating a seamless customer experience, making weekend bar jobs extremely collaborative environments.
